This role will lead the shift emergency response team (ERT) with a high level of knowledge of fire systems. The position reports directly to the Site Facilities Manager and works closely with the Shift Operations Manager.

  • Operate and maintain all Site Fire Systems.
  • Lead the ERT team during emergencies.
  • Serve as the primary responder and controller for site first aid and medical incidents.
  • Support general activities related to site facilities.
  • Act as the primary responder for site security incidents.
  • Manage the Site Hot Work Permit system.
  • Oversee relevant risk assessments and safe systems of work (SSOW) for the area.
